Dear All,
A few Tele-sales staff here at Gold Card Ladprao are unhappy with our office rules of 50 baht penalty per lateness, automatically deducted through Weekly Labour Report, as they're complaining and comparing staff on other Centara programmes are not being penalised for lateness.
To improve punctuality and keeping the same standard at all Centara programmes, please immediately implement the same office rules or Policy as below at your programme starting from tomorrow, brief and get all staff to acknowledge this new rule.
Policy Statement: All staff must arrive at office before the morning briefing starts (or the afternoon briefing for part-timer who works in the afternoon shift only), failing which will result to a 50 baht fine, deducted through Weekly Labour Report. Exception may be made in case of emergency and with advance notice via phone call to PD before briefing starts, and include any special agreement between any staff and the PD that allows the staff to start work by a specific time such as 9:45 or 10:00am if any staff genuinely unable to comply due to family obligations such as the need to take care of children before start work, etc. However, should such exception is made, 9:46am is late if the agreed time is 9:45am, and 10:01am is late if the agreed time is 10:00am.
Objective: Morning briefing can start on time and without interruption in the middle of it and all sales staff must be expected to start selling at once (same time with everyone in the team) as soon as the briefing is complete. This is also part of the office rules and standard expectations in order for a discipline and productive team to be established.
